Technicolour brights!!  Had a little challenge trying to get the royal purple, navy blue and in your face orange balanced so please squint and imagine........  So I cut my brand new Die-Versions Beach House die from navy card.  Then I wasn't sure what to do with it so I tossed it on my desk and it landed on this purple card.  I may have to use that technique more often!!!!  I had an image of a glorious sunrise so I raided the scraps box for some orange, cut long thin triangle type shapes and arranged them behind my island diecut.  Then I coloured Unity's There Was a Boy in tropical shades and added him to the scene.  I want to be there too.........
